a. Bot. [f. as prec. + -FORM.] Calyptra-shaped.
1830. Lindley, Nat. Syst. Bot., 46. The corolla is calyptriform in Antholoma.
1880. Gray, Bot. Text-bk., 400. Calyptriform. Calyptra-shaped; as the calyx of Eschscholtzia.
So Calyptrimorphous a. [Gr. μορφή form.] Applied in Botany to ascidia which have a distinct lid. Syd. Soc. Lex., 1881.
